Phone number ☎️ 01603451323 👆 is reported as an automated call pretending to be a bank security service, warning about a card payment for train tickets from Edinburgh to London. The message asks to press 1 to confirm or 2 to reject the payment but does not specify the bank name, who the payment was made to, or the amount involved. Users found it suspicious due to lack of detail and unclear legitimacy.

About 01 Numbers

The indicated num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are commonly used by domestic and commercial premises.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are dependent on the time of day. Several service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
